Sagging roof repair services address a common issue that can develop over time due to various structural or material problems. When a roof begins to sag, it often indicates that the underlying support structures, such as rafters or trusses, are compromised. This can be caused by prolonged exposure to moisture, rotting wood, or the failure of roofing materials. Repairing a sagging roof typically involves inspecting the affected areas, reinforcing or replacing weakened support beams, and ensuring the roof's overall stability. Proper repair helps prevent further damage, such as leaks or collapse, and restores the integrity of the property’s roof.

This service is essential for resolving specific problems associated with a sagging roof. Common signs include visible dips or uneven sections on the roofline, interior ceilings showing signs of bowing or cracking, and increased susceptibility to leaks during heavy rain.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ent more extensive damage and costly repairs down the line. Sagging roofs can also compromise the safety of a property, making it important to have a professional evaluation to determine whether repairs or more extensive reinforcement is needed.

Properties that typically require sagging roof repair include residential homes, especially older houses with aging support structures, as well as multi-family buildings and small commercial properties. Homes with previous water damage, poor ventilation, or inadequate roof maintenance are more prone to developing sagging issues. Additionally, properties located in areas prone to heavy snowfall or high winds may experience increased stress on their roofs, making regular inspections and timely repairs vital. What are signs of a sagging roof that need repair? Indicators include visible dips or uneven areas on the roof surface, cracked or missing shingles, and interior issues like water stains or leaks on ceilings and walls.

Can a sagging roof be repaired without a full replacement? Yes, local contractors often perform repairs such as shingle replacement, structural reinforcement, or joist repairs to address sagging areas without replacing the entire roof.

What causes a roof to start sagging? Common causes include prolonged exposure to moisture, structural damage from storms or heavy snow, and deterioration of supporting beams or trusses over time.

How can I prevent my roof from sagging in the future? Regular inspections, prompt repairs of minor issues, and ensuring proper attic ventilation can help maintain roof integrity and prevent sagging.
